No it's not illegal, matter of fact I recently e-mailed Scott S. about the possibility of this (ADP) happening on the new Camaro if and when it comes out. I told him this additional dealer mark-up will probably ruin possible record sales for the new Camaro, since many prospective buyers will be priced out of the market. He responded that GM is very furious about the ADP, but nothing can be done since it would be a violation of anti-trust laws for a manufacturer to demand a product to be sold at MSRP. This works on the upside as well as the downside of pricing. I guess the new Camaro will take its place next to the new T-Bird. C
